Document Jam

The error message Document Jam or Document Jam/too Long is an indication that the document was not inserted or fed correctly, or the document scanned from the Automatic Document Feeder (ADF) was too long.

 

Follow the steps below to clear a document jam.

 

  1. Remove the jammed document from the ADF unit. Clear any debris or scraps of paper from the ADF unit paper path.
    Check the following points to take out jammed document:
  2. Set the document in the ADF correctly.
